Overview

Drywall built for Lisle.

Lisle work runs from Green Trails kitchen and basement remodels to office suites along the Warrenville Road corporate corridor. The residential side is mostly 1970s-through-1990s homes that need textured ceilings removed, joints re-taped, and basements finished properly. The commercial side wants clean partition walls and fast turnarounds so a suite can be re-leased on schedule.

Our crews work throughout Lisle, IL. Lisle mixes a small downtown near the Metra station with 1970s-90s subdivisions like Green Trails and Beau Bien, the large Four Lakes condominium community, and one of DuPage County's densest corporate office corridors along Warrenville Road and Corporate Lane. That corporate base makes commercial tenant work a bigger share of our Lisle volume than in most nearby villages.

Multi-story Four Lakes buildings concentrate water damage - a single upstairs supply-line failure can affect three units - while DuPage heating-season dryness opens joints in the single-family subdivisions each winter.

Repair Work

Drywall Repair in Lisle, IL

Most calls we take in Lisle start with a repair - a nail pop above a doorway, a hairline crack over a window, a stained ceiling after a roof leak, or a hole where a doorknob punched through drywall. Our crews handle those repairs the same way we approach a full remodel: contain the dust, fix the underlying cause, and blend the patch so it disappears under paint and raking light.

In older Lisle homes we often see settlement cracks along seams and corner bead damage where framing has moved with DuPage County's freeze-thaw cycles. Instead of skim-coating over the symptom, we reinforce the joint with paper or mesh tape, re-bed corner bead where it has separated, and float three thin coats of joint compound so the repair holds through the next humidity swing.

Water-damaged ceilings are the other common repair in Lisle. Ice dams, plumbing leaks, and second-floor bathroom overflows leave stained, sagging drywall that has to come out - not just get painted over. We cut back to sound framing, replace insulation if it is wet, hang new panels with matching thickness, tape the seams, and re-texture to match the surrounding ceiling before priming with a stain-blocking sealer.

Texture matching is where most drywall repairs fail. Knockdown, orange peel, skip trowel, and light hand-textures all read differently under Lisle lighting, so our finishers test the texture on a scrap panel first, adjust the spray tip and mud consistency, and only then apply it to the wall. When the paint goes on, the repair should be invisible - that is the standard we work to on every Lisle call.

New Installation

Drywall Installation in Lisle, IL

For Lisle additions, basement finishes, whole-room remodels, and new-construction projects, our installation crews hang, tape, mud, and finish drywall to a paint-ready standard. We work with your general contractor, remodeler, or directly with the homeowner - and we sequence coats around DuPage County's seasonal humidity so seams stay flat months after the paint dries.

Every Lisle installation starts with panel selection. Standard 1/2" for walls, 5/8" Type X where code requires fire-rated assemblies, moisture-resistant board for bathrooms and basement perimeters, and lightweight ceiling panels for spans that would sag under standard rock. We deliver material a day ahead so panels acclimate to the room before they go up on the framing.

Hanging is where a good finish is won or lost. We stagger seams, keep butt joints off the center of long walls, back-block where we can, and screw to code without over-driving fasteners. Tape and mud follow - one coat of setting-type compound with paper tape, then two coats of topping compound, sanded between coats with mesh screens to knock down ridges without scarring the paper face.

Finish level matters more than most Lisle homeowners realize. Level 3 is fine behind heavy texture, Level 4 is the residential standard under flat and eggshell paint, and Level 5 - a full skim coat over the entire wall - is what we deliver when raking window light, satin sheens, or dark paint colors would telegraph every seam. We recommend the level up front and put it in the estimate, so there is no guessing at the finish stage.

Can you remove textured ceilings?

+

Yes. Anything installed before 1980 gets asbestos testing first; then we scrape, skim, sand, and finish smooth or re-texture to match.
